Gary Bettman On Expansion

06/02/2016 at 8:17pm EDT

from Ryan McKenna of Sportsnet,

Gary Bettman says that re-alignment for possible expansion teams is something that has to be resolved.

Speaking on Prime Time Sports Thursday, the NHL commissioner went into detail about how that scenario could play out.

“There are issues at 17 and 15 (teams) that I know are more difficult than 14 and 16,” said Bettman. “And I think that if you asked for example, Columbus or Detroit, who went East, they would not happily or be agreeable to moving back to the West.”

The Blue Jackets and Red Wings switched conferences prior to the 2013-14 season as part of the league’s realignment.

"I don’t think it would be appropriate to ask them to go West again so that isn’t even on the table, to ask them to do."
